Onametostat is a novel inhibitor of the protein arginine methyltransferase 5 (PRMT5). PRMT5 is a key enzyme, and overactive PRMT5 is closely related to the occurrence and development of a variety of cancers, so it becomes an important target for anticancer drug development. Onametostat, by selectively inhibiting the activity of PRMT5 and preventing it from catalyzing symmetric dimethylation of arginine residues, thereby interfering with the growth and proliferation of cancer cells, shows promising prospects in the treatment of tumors with overexpression of PRMT5.

M.Wt | 483.37 |
Cas No. | 2086772-26-9 |
Formula | C22H23BrN6O2 |
Solubility | ≥16.33 mg/mL in DMSO with ultrasonic; ≥4.1 mg/mL in EtOH with ultrasonic; insoluble in H2O |
Chemical Name | (1S,2R,3S,5R)-3-(2-(2-amino-3-bromoquinolin-7-yl)ethyl)-5-(4-amino-7H-pyrrolo[2,3-d]pyrimidin-7-yl)cyclopentane-1,2-diol |
